Bahamas - Whole Fresh Cow Milk Producing Population

Since 2014, Bahamas Whole Fresh Cow Milk Producing Population decreased by 2.1% year on year. At 670 Heads in 2019, the country was ranked number 181 comparing other countries in Whole Fresh Cow Milk Producing Population. Bahamas is overtaken by Grenada, which was number 180 with 687 Heads and is followed by French Polynesia at 586 Heads. India lead the ranking with 53,000,000 Heads in 2019, that is an increase of 0.3% versus 2018. Brazil, Pakistan and United States resp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Martinique recorded the best 5 years average growth at +26.9% per year, while Jamaica was the worst growing country at -17.2% per year.
